[QUOTE="DammitJanet, post: 478829, member: 1514"] Lisa, when you cut off your phone, make sure you do leave your phone as a number is forwarded to your cell. Or to easy child's number. Not just cut off with no forwarding number. It wont last forever but at least it will for a time. even though you dont want to do it...I would call the schools to see if the kids are there. If they are still there, Maybe you could ask the guidance counselor to bring Kayla in privately and talk to her and tell her that she is giving her your private cell to keep in a safe place not to be given to her mother or father just in case she ever needs it in an emergency. Like on a small business card to keep in a book or something. Maybe Kayla would be smart enough to write it down inside a shoe or the binding of a book she always takes with her...something. The school can also keep it to send with the school records and send a message along with the kids school records to remind Kayla privately. The guidance counselor can also tell her how to make a call to you with a dollar because you cant accept a collect call on a cell but most pay phones will let you make any long distance calls for about 30 minutes for a dollar now.
